The guns at Sutter’s Fort, mostly used to make a strong impression on the locals, were a varied collection drawn from passing ships and from the Russians at Fort Ross in what is now Sonoma County. The armament, as early as 1842, consisted of two brass fieldpieces and a dozen or more iron guns of different kinds brought from Hawaii […]
